The Lincoln MKS is a full-size luxury sedan from Lincoln. The MKS was first shown as a 2009 model year the LA Auto Show in November 2007. The MKS began production in May 2008 with sales beginning a month later.
The Lincoln MKS continues Lincoln's three-letter nomenclature for new models, preceded by the MKZ, MKT, and MKX, and followed by the MKC. The MKS became the marque's sole full-size sedan in the 2012 model year with the discontinuation of the Town Car. The MKS then became the longest domestic production sedan at 205.6in (17.13ft; 5.22m) overall length.
